The Type 1 Diabetes Score in 20130, Paris, Virginia is 95 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

100.00 percent of the population in 20130 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 21.13 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 28.17 percent of the residents in 20130 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.38 members with about 2.14 cars available per household.

An estimate of 92.16 percent of the residents in 20130 has some form of health insurance. 12.55 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 83.53 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 20130 would have to travel an average of 21.57 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Uva Health Haymarket Medical Center .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 20130, Paris, Virginia.

As of , an estimate of 255 residents live in 20130 with a median age of 42.8 years. 22.35 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 12.94 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 44.44 percent of the residents in 20130 is currently married, and 21.21 percent of the population has never been married.

Understanding the history of the area can provide valuable insight for potential movers. Paris, Virginia has a rich history dating back to its founding in the early 19th century. The town was named after the capital of France in honor of Marquis de Lafayette's service during the American Revolutionary War. Today, Paris maintains its small-town charm while offering proximity to urban amenities in nearby cities.
